CORGI, or the Council of Registered Gas Installers, ceased to be the UK's official register for gas engineers in 2009 and was replaced with the Gas Safe Register. However, despite this change, the legacy of CORGI's television advertisements is so strong that people still consider it to be a government-backed mark of quality and safety. In fact 27% of those who responded to a survey stated that they would request proof of registration with CORGI from an engineer before they do.
The poll, conducted in advance of Gas Safety Week (16-22 September) found that CORGI registration is a key aspect in the perceptions of consumers of gas engineers. This was more influential than the recommendations from family and friends and specific experience positive online reviews and accreditations from manufacturers. The results suggest that there is an abundance of confusion among UK consumers regarding the standards and bodies that regulate gas work. This is troubling considering that, as per law, anyone working with gas must be registered with the Gas Safe Register. If they're not registered, they're operating illegally.

CORGI has ceased to be the official register for gas engineers in the UK. Instead, the new register is called the Gas Safe Register. The switch has been a difficult one for a few consumers, who see CORGI registration as an indication of competence and reliability. Many engineers have decided to avoid the term "CORGI-registered" to make their customers feel comfortable.
The new Gas Safe Register is a mandatory scheme that is designed to improve standards of gas service engineer near me engineering and safety. In addition to registering gas engineers the register also checks their qualifications and investigates complaints regarding unsafe installations. The new registry has replaced the previous CORGI registry and will be under the supervision of the Health and Safety Executive. Anyone who is not listed on the registry is not legally able to carry out domestic gas work.
